Bühler Smart Mill is a model of Bühler”s Swiss headquarters combined with localized innovation in China. On the one hand, it absorbs Swiss high-tech
innovative products, and on the other hand, it combines feedback from the Chinese market to form a good two-way feedback mechanism, ultimately achieving
localized innovation and better creating higher value for local customers.
In the core part of the process, Smart Mill uses a mill (MDDR/MDDT) imported from Switzerland, which not only ensures stable grinding effect and stability,
but also has the function of automatic adjustment of rolling distance. Combined with localized advanced engineering design concepts and process standards,
through stable operating hardware equipment, intelligent control systems and solutions, information collected from online equipment can be analyzed in real time
to achieve “Machine to Machine” Communication, thereby automatically adjusting process parameters, such as rolling distance, ash content, color, etc.; it can also
implement complex operations such as incoming material processing, protein content, etc., and ultimately achieve controllable, customized, and high-quality production.
At the same time, Bühler Smart Mill is also an important result of the collaboration between industry, academia and research institutes. It is a benchmark project for
intelligent manufacturing in the grain industry that integrates Bühler”s innovation ecosystem, universities and industry experts. At the end of 2020, the China Cereals
and Oils Society organized relevant experts to evaluate the results of the Smart Mill intelligent factory project in the Hainan Free Trade Port jointly completed by Henan
University of Technology, Bühler China, Hainan Hengfeng and other units. The expert group believed that: the project The results are innovative and the overall technology
has reached the international leading level. It is recommended to further strengthen the promotion of the results.
Since 2017, Bühler smart factories have helped customers such as Hengfeng and Jaffagard achieve success, improving their sustainable production
capabilities and profitability. Compared with traditional factories, smart factories can meet the needs of integrated enterprise management and control, lean management
and control of processing processes, optimization of finished products and product diversification, and can achieve full traceability of the production process. On the basis
of ensuring food security, Stable and efficient product output.
